The new authentic Germany home shirt with adidas TECHFIT POWERWEB Technonogy is now available through the FSC Shop. This is a replica shirt to the standard worn by the German National team.

Displayed in a presentation box 53cm x 43cm x 11cm and accompanied by a German captains armband this is a must have item.

adidas TECHFIT POWERWEB technology is built into every shirt and helps to provide:

- 1.1% increased sprinting speed
- Improved posture, enhanced accuracy and repeatability through increased spatial awareness.
- 5.3% improved strength, body posture and overall average output.
- 4% improved vertical jump height.
- 0.8% increased efficiency and improved spatial awareness by decreasing oxygen consumption by 0.8%.
